What is the Cabinet?
The Cabinet, also known as the Executive, is the main policy-making body of the Council and carries out Council functions that are not the responsibility of any other part of the Council, whether by law or under the constitution. It consists of an Executive Leader together with at least 2, but no more than 9, Councillors appointed by the Executive Leader.
At Wigan, the Cabinet (Executive) consists of eight senior Councillors who are each ‘Portfolio Holders’ for a major area of responsibility.
The Leader will maintain a list, setting out which individual Cabinet members are responsible for particular functions.
From May 2025, the Executive Leader has decided that eight Lead members will support the Cabinet members and attend Cabinet meetings.
In accordance with the Local Government Acts 1972 and 2000, they will not have decision-making powers in their own right.
See below names of portfolios of the eight Cabinet members and eight Lead members.
Cabinet members 2025/26
- David Molyneux MBE - Executive Leader, Portfolio holder for Economic Development and Regeneration
- Keith Cunliffe - Deputy Leader, Portfolio holder for Adult Social Care
- Paul Prescott - Portfolio holder for Planning, Environmental Services and Transport
- Dane Anderton - Portfolio holder for Children and Families
- Nazia Rehman - Portfolio holder for Finance, Resources and Transformation
- Susan Gambles - Portfolio holder for Housing and Welfare
- Chris Ready - Portfolio holder for Communities and Neighbourhoods
- Kevin Anderson - Portfolio holder for Police, Crime and Civil Contingencies.
Lead members 2025/26
- Samantha Brown - Lead Member for Climate Response and Sustainability
- Danny Fletcher - Lead Member for Leisure and Public Health
- Martyn Smethurst - Lead Member for Armed Forces and Veterans
- Yvonne Klieve - Lead Member for District Centres and Night Time Economy
- Laura Flynn - Lead Member for Youth Opportunities and Equalities
- Lawrence Hunt - Lead Member for Heritage and Building Conservation
- Lee McStein - Lead Member for Crime Prevention
- Paul Molyneux - Lead Member for Finance and Resources.
